Warriors Trade Jonathan Kuminga to Eastern Conference: Report

Summary

The Golden State Warriors have traded Jonathan Kuminga and Buddy Hield to the Atlanta Hawks. In exchange, the Warriors received Kristaps Porzingis. This move comes as the Warriors aim to strengthen their team with Porzingis' experience.

Key Facts

  • The Warriors traded Jonathan Kuminga and Buddy Hield to the Atlanta Hawks.
  • In return, the Warriors received Kristaps Porzingis.
  • Kuminga was previously a key reserve player for the Warriors during their 2022 NBA Championship.
  • Kuminga averaged 12.5 points per game over five seasons with the Warriors.
  • Buddy Hield played 126 games for the Warriors, averaging 10 points per game.
  • Kristaps Porzingis previously played for the Hawks and is known for his championship experience.
  • The Warriors made an additional trade, sending Trayce Jackson-Davis to the Toronto Raptors for a future draft pick.
